Banking security and transaction monitoring technologies
Overview
Financial institutions are utilizing behavioral protection to defend against cybercriminals. This technology analyzes user interactions with devices, such as typing speed, mouse movements, and screen scrolling patterns, to detect unauthorized access. The system is described as contextless, meaning it does not monitor the content of messages, passwords, or specific transaction details.
Additionally, banks employ security systems to monitor transactions for signs of money laundering and terrorism financing. These systems analyze the frequency, recipient, and history of operations rather than just transaction amounts. Unusual patterns, such as frequent small transfers that appear to be splitting a larger transaction, may trigger scrutiny and reporting to the General Inspector of Financial Information.
